Webinar: Windows Clustering for SQL: High Availability & Disaster Recovery

May 14, 2019 by Jason Aw Leave a Comment

Windows Clustering for SQL 101 A Practical Guide to High Availability and Disaster Recovery for SQL Server

Webinar: Windows Clustering for SQL 101: A Practical Guide to High Availability and Disaster Recovery for SQL Server

In this recorded webinar, Microsoft Cloud and Datacenter Management MVP, David Bermingham describes how to use Windows Server Failover Clustering to provide high availability and disaster protection for SQL Server. This presentation begins with an overview of the basics of Windows Server Failover Clustering and how they work. Dave also gives practical advice on understanding your configuration options. He also answers common Windows Server Failover Clustering questions, such as: What are the benefits and drawbacks of traditional SAN-based clusters? What is a SANLess cluster and how do I build one? What are the best practices for using Windows Server Failover Clustering to ensure disaster recovery protection?
